The case of Alex and Derek King, two young brothers embroiled in a crime that sent shockwaves through the community, is something straight out of a gritty crime drama. Back in 2001, these kids, just 12 and 13, found themselves in the national spotlight for the unthinkable – the murder of their own father. This wasn’t just a headline-grabbing story; it was a deep dive into the murky waters of juvenile crime and what happens when the justice system has to deal with kids who commit adult-sized offenses.

Let’s set the scene: two young boys, a household riddled with issues, and a father found dead. The boys confessed, but that was just the beginning of a complicated and twisted tale. The plot thickened with the involvement of Ricky Chavis, a man with a disturbing background, who some believed was the puppeteer behind this tragedy. The boys’ trial wasn’t just about guilt or innocence; it was a jarring look into their troubled lives, filled with abuse and neglect. It begged the question: were these kids monsters, or were they just dealt a really bad hand in life?

The courtroom drama that unfolded was as complex as the boys’ story. With Chavis in the mix, the legal waters got murkier. Was he the mastermind, or were the boys acting alone? This wasn’t just a legal puzzle; it was a moral one too. How do you fairly punish kids who’ve committed a serious crime but have also been through so much?

Then came the sentencing – a moment that sparked a national debate. Life in prison for kids? The final decision to reduce their sentences threw a spotlight on a big issue: how do we balance punishment with a chance for rehabilitation when it comes to young offenders?

In wrapping up, the King brothers’ case is more than a crime story; it’s a hard look at the challenges of dealing with juvenile offenders. It’s about figuring out how to navigate the fine line between justice and understanding, especially for kids who’ve had a rough start in life. Their story is a stark reminder of the complexities and tragedies that can unfold when young lives go astray, and the heavy responsibility on the shoulders of the justice system to respond with both firmness and compassion.
